RE: The tariff classification of infant girl’s apparel from the Philippines.
Dear Mr. Stone:
In your undated letter received by our office August 31, 2010, you requested a tariff classification ruling. As requested, the samples will be returned to you.
The submitted sample is a babies’ dress, diaper cover and hat set. The sample does not have a style number. The items are made of woven self-fabric that is 60% cotton, 40% polyester. The dress has short puff sleeves, a round neckline with smocking and embroidery and appliqué work, an A-line silhouette and a three button back opening. The diaper cover has elasticized fabric at the waist and ruffle leg openings. The bonnet style hat has a tie neck closure and an elasticized back band. The submitted item is a size newborn.
The applicable subheading for the dress will be 6209.20.1000,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States, (HTSUS), which provides for babies’ garments and clothing accessories, of cotton, dresses. The duty rate will be 11.8% ad valorem.
The applicable subheading for the diaper cover and hat will be 6209.20.5045,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States, (HTSUS), which provides for babies’ garments and clothing accessories, of cotton, other, other, other, imported as parts of sets. The duty rate will be 9.3% ad valorem.
